What affects the price

When you look at merchant cash advance rates, the final number depends on your business's specific situation. Lenders evaluate your recent bank statements, the consistency of your daily credit card sales, and how long you have been operating. If you have a high volume of steady revenue, you might secure more favorable terms. Conversely, if your cash flow is erratic or your business is newer, the risk level increases, which impacts the offer. What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ance is a financial product where a business receives a lump sum of cash upfront. In return, they agree to pay back the advance plus a fee. This repayment is typically made through a percentage of the business's future credit card sales. It's a fast way to get capital.
